The log building at this site was originally S.S.#1, the first schoolhouse in Cardiff Twp.—built by Walter Kidd in the 1890s. Originally located on the Kidd property near Dyno Estates it was moved in the 1970’s to Hwy 28 as a tourist booth and then moved in 2005 to its present site where it serves as a local history museum and genealogical database of the pioneering families.

The other building was the Highland Grove school. It now functions as a public library and community centre where the “Ladies of the Grove” serve up memorable suppers.
